Sensor sensitivity

In automatic mode, a sensor in the appliance detects
the intensity of the cooking and roasting fumes.
Depending on the sensor setting, the fan automatically
switches itself to another fan setting.
Default sensitivity setting: 2
Lowest sensitivity setting: 1
Highest sensitivity setting: 4
Changing the sensitivity of the sensor
If the sensor control system reacts too quickly or too
slowly, change the sensitivity setting.
You can set the sensitivity in the Home Connect app.

Intensive setting

Activate intensive mode if strong odours or large
amounts of steam are produced. In this mode, the
appliance operates at its maximum fan setting for a
short time. After approx. 6 minutes, the appliance will
automatically switch back to fan setting 3.

Run-on function

The run-on function leaves the ventilation system
running at a low fan setting for a few minutes after it has
been switched off. While the run-on function is switched
on, the illuminated ring behind the control knob slowly
flashes orange. The appliance automatically switches
off the ventilation after approx. 20 minutes.
The fan run-on removes any remaining kitchen fumes
and reduces the condensation in the appliance.
Notes
You can activate or deactivate the run-on function in
the basic settings or in the Home Connect app.
The run-on function does not start unless the
appliance has been switched on for at least two
minutes.
The run-on function only starts in circulating-air
mode.

Intermittent ventilation

With intermittent ventilation, the fan automatically
switches to fan setting 1 for 6 minutes every hour.
Switching on
Push in the control knob and turn it clockwise to the
position.
Intermittent ventilation is activated. The illuminated ring
behind the control knob will be lit orange while the
ventilation system is switched on.
Switching off
Turn the control knob anti-clockwise to position 0.

Saturation display

When the metal grease filter or the activated charcoal
filter (only in circulating-air mode) are saturated, the
illuminated ring on the control knob flashes:
Metal grease filter: Three times white, slow
flashing
Activated charcoal filter: Six times white, rapid
flashing
Do not wait any longer to clean the metal grease filters
or replace or regenerate the activated charcoal
filters.~

Ventilation moulding

If the downdraft ventilation operates beside a gas-fired
appliance, a ventilation moulding AA 414 010 must be
attached when cooking. The ventilation moulding
improves the extraction behaviour for gas-fired
appliances. The ventilation moulding prevents small
flames from going out as a result of a draft.
